Viewing the array configuration
To view information about the RAID array, complete the following steps:
1. Start the Adaptec RAID Configuration Utility program.
2. Select Array Configuration Utility.
3. From the Main menu, select Manage Arrays.
4. Select an array and press Enter.
5. To exit from the program, press Esc.
Using ServeRAID Manager
Use ServeRAID Manager, which is on the IBM ServeRAID Support CD, to:
v Configure a redundant array of independent disks (RAID) array
v Restore a SAS hard disk drive to the factory-default settings, erasing all data
from the disk
v View the RAID configuration and associated devices
v Monitor the operation of the RAID controllers
To
perform some tasks, you can run ServeRAID Manager as an installed program.
However, to configure the installed ServeRAID controller and perform an initial
RAID configuration on the server, you must run ServeRAID Manager in Startable
CD mode, as described in the instructions in this section. If you install a different
type of RAID adapter in the server, use the configuration method that is described
in the instructions that come with that adapter to view or change SAS settings for
attached devices.
See the ServeRAID documentation on the IBM ServeRAID Support CD for
additional information about RAID technology and instructions for using ServeRAID
Manager to configure the installed ServeRAID controller. Additional information
about ServeRAID Manager is also available from the Help menu. For information
about a specific object in the ServeRAID Manager tree, select the object and click
Actions --> Hints and tips.
Configuring the controller
By running ServeRAID Manager in Startable CD mode, you can configure the
installed controller before you install the operating system. The information in this
section assumes that you are running ServeRAID Manager in Startable CD mode.
To run ServeRAID Manager in Startable CD mode, turn on the server; then, insert
the CD into the CD drive. If ServeRAID Manager detects an unconfigured controller
and ready drives, the Configuration wizard starts.
